Gum disease is treatable isn't it?

Yes it is.  Depending on the severity of course.  Sometimes it can be so severe that teeth need to be removed.  If its gingivitis, its reversible.  If its more severe though, you may need more regular maintenance and improve your hygiene.

The future prognosis of your gum disease would be based upon the depth of the pockets, how much bleeding, how much gum has shrunk or receded, any bone loss, mobility and various other factors.  If its just starting the process, proper dental treatment and improved oral hygiene should help out.  If there is any underlying disease which may be associated with the gum disease should be controlled too such as diabetes.  Also, some medications can cause dry mouth which contribute to hygiene problems.
